Stop your hose from twisting — and protect it from the inside out. The 1/2" high-pressure swivel lets the nozzle rotate freely while the hose stays stationary. Without one, every rotation the nozzle makes winds up the hose, and over time that twist destroys it from within.
This is one of those parts operators overlook until a hose fails early. Jetter hose isn't built to be twisted; the reinforcement inside is laid to handle pressure, not torque. When a nozzle spins in the line — and many of them do — that rotation transfers straight into the hose as accumulated twist, breaking down the reinforcement from the inside where you can't see it. A swivel decouples the two: the nozzle turns, the hose doesn't, and the twist never builds. It's a small, inexpensive fitting that routinely saves a hose worth many times its price.
